BACKGROUND Angioleiomyoma is a rare and benign stromal tumor typically found in subcutaneous tissue.It rarely occurs in the gastrointestinal tract.Among the reported cases,the most common complication was gastrointestinal bleeding.Perforation has only been reported as a complication in the last few decades.CASE SUMMARY This case report detailed the discovery of intestinal angioleiomyoma in a 47-yearold male presenting with abdominal pain that had persisted for 3 d.After suspecting hollow organ perforation,surgical intervention involving intestinal resection and anastomosis was performed.CONCLUSION The report underscores the significance of early surgical intervention in effectively treating angioleiomyoma while emphasizing the pivotal role of timely and appropriate measures for favorable outcomes. 展开更多

BACKGROUND While colorectal polyps are not cancerous,some types of polyps,known as adenomas,can develop into colorectal cancer over time.Polyps can often be found and removed by colonoscopy;however,this is an invasive and expensive test.Thus,there is a need for new methods of screening patients at high risk of developing polyps.AIM To identify a potential association between colorectal polyps and small intestine bacteria overgrowth(SIBO)or other relevant factors in a patient cohort with lactulose breath test(LBT)results.METHODS A total of 382 patients who had received an LBT were classified into polyp and non-polyp groups that were confirmed by colonoscopy and pathology.SIBO was diagnosed by measuring LBTderived hydrogen(H)and methane(M)levels according to 2017 North American Consensus recommendations.Logistic regression was used to assess the ability of LBT to predict colorectal polyps.Intestinal barrier function damage(IBFD)was determined by blood assays.RESULTS H and M levels revealed that the prevalence of SIBO was significantly higher in the polyp group than in the non-polyp group(41%vs 23%,P<0.01;71%vs 59%,P<0.05,respectively).Within 90 min of lactulose ingestion,the peak H values in the adenomatous and inflammatory/hyperplastic polyp patients were significantly higher than those in the non-polyp group(P<0.01,and P=0.03,respectively).In 227 patients with SIBO defined by combining H and M values,the rate of IBFD determined by blood lipopolysaccharide levels was significantly higher among patients with polyps than those without(15%vs 5%,P<0.05).In regression analysis with age and gender adjustment,colorectal polyps were most accurately predicted with models using M peak values or combined H and M values limited by North American Consensus recommendations for SIBO.These models had a sensitivity of≥0.67,a specificity of≥0.64,and an accuracy of≥0.66.CONCLUSION The current study made key associations among colorectal polyps,SIBO,and IBFD and demonstrated that LBT has moderate potential as an alternative noninvasive screening tool for colorectal polyps. 展开更多

Long non-coding RNAs(lncRNAs)are a class of transcripts longer than 200 bp,which have been emerged as essential regulators in numerous biological processes.Black rockfish(Sebastes schlegelii)is an economic fish that widely cultured in the coastal areas of China,Japan,and South Korea.With the expansion of aquacultural scale,various pathogens have threatened its industry and reduced its economic values.It has been reported that lncRNA were involved in the immune response and metabolic pathway in teleost,while no study is available on identification and functional analysis of lncRNAs in black rockfish so far.Herein,this study was performed to identify lncRNAs in the intestine of black rockfish after Edwardsiella tarda infection.In our results,a total of 9311 lncRNAs were identified through highthroughput sequencing,and 102 lncRNAs were significantly regulated following challenge,which were predicted to target 3348 mRNAs.Results of Gene Ontology(GO)and Kyoto Encyclopedia of Genes and Genomes(KEGG)enrichment analyses of the se target genes showed they were function in catalytic activity,hydrolase activity,defense response and peptidase activity,which involved in metabolic pathways and immune related pathways.In addition,47 lncRNAs and 8 differentially expressed mRNAs(DEmRNAs)showed co-expression at two or more infection time points with metabolism and immunity functions.Moreover,real-time quantitative PCR(qRT-PCR)was performed to verify the reliability of sequencing gene expression analysis results.This research laid the foundation for further investigation of the regulatory roles of lncRNAs in the intestinal immune response of black rockfish. 展开更多

Background:This study aimed to develop a combined model to quantify the net absorption of volatile fatty acids(VFA)in the large intestine(LI)of pigs.Methods:Fifteen female growing pigs(Duroc×Large White×Landrace)were ranked by body weight(30±2.1 kg)on day 0 and assigned to one of three treatments,namely the basal diet containing different crude fiber(CF)levels(LCF:3.0%CF,MCF:4.5%CF,and HCF:6.0%CF).The pigs were implanted with the terminal ileum fistula and the cannulation of the ileal mesenteric vein(IMV),portal vein(PV),and left femoral artery(LFA)from days 6 to 7.[13 C]-Labeled VFA and P-aminohippuric acid were constantly perfused into the terminal ileum fistula and the cannulation of the IMV(day 15),respectively.Blood samples were collected from the PV and the LFA during perfusion(5 h),and LI samples were collected.Results:The net flux of[12 C]-acetic acid in the PV was greater for LCF versus MCF(p=0.045),but no difference was observed in the net flux of[12 C]-propionic acid(p=0.505)and[12 C]-butyric acid(p=0.35)in the PV among treatments.The deposition of[12 C]-acetic acid in the LI was greater for LCF versus MCF(p=0.014),whereas the deposition of[12 C]-propionic acid(p=0.007)and[12 C]-butyric acid(p=0.037)in the LI was greater for LCF versus HCF.Conclusions:In conclusion,this pig model was found conducive to study the net absorption of VFAs in the LI,and LCF had more net absorption of VFAs in the LI than MCF and HCF. 展开更多

BACKGROUND Cholangiocarcinoma and small intestine cancer are common clinical malignancies,but metastatic cholangiocarcinoma and small intestine cancer are rare,especially simultaneous metastatic cholangiocarcinoma and small intestine cancer from breast cancer.Since the clinical presentation of metastatic cholangiocarcinoma and small intestine cancer does not differ from primary tumor,it may lead to misdiagnosis preoperatively.CASE SUMMARY A 66-year-old woman was admitted to our hospital for further treatment due to abdominal pain and jaundice.Abdominal magnetic resonance imaging and magnetic resonance cholangiopancreatography showed an occupying lesion of the bile duct,considering a high possibility of primary bile duct tumor.Therefore,we performed a radical bile duct cancer surgery and cholecystectomy,and multiple tumors in the small intestine were found and removed during the surgery process.Postoperative pathology showed metastatic bile duct cancer and small intestine cancer from tumors in other parts.The patient underwent a right total mastectomy and axillary lymph node dissection because of right breast cancer 2 years ago.Combining with the immunohistochemical results,the patient was finally diagnosed as metastatic cholangiocarcinoma and metastatic small intestine cancer from breast cancer.Postoperatively,the patient received four cycles of chemotherapy and targeted therapy with docetaxel,capecitabine and trastuzumab.Unfortunately,the patient eventually died from tumor progression,thoracoabdominal infection,and sepsis 5 mo after surgery.CONCLUSION Simultaneous metastatic cholangiocarcinoma and small intestine cancer from breast cancer are rare and the prognosis is extremely poor.Improving preoperative diagnostic accuracy is beneficial to avoid excessive surgical treatment.Treatment should be aimed at relieving biliary obstruction and abdominal pain,and then supplemented with chemotherapy and targeted therapy to control tumor progression and prolong the patient’s life. 展开更多

Nine major cell populations among 46,716 cells were identified in mouse intestinal ischemia‒reperfusion(II/R)injury by single-cell RNA sequencing.For enterocyte cells,11 subclusters were found,in which enterocyte cluster 1(EC1),enterocyte cluster 3(EC3),and enterocyte cluster 8(EC8)were newly discovered cells in ischemia 45 min/reperfusion 720 min(I 45 min/R 720 min)group.EC1 and EC3 played roles in digestion and absorption,and EC8 played a role in cell junctions.For TA cells,after ischemia 45 min/reperfusion 90 min(I 45 min/R 90 min),many TA cells at the stage of proliferation were identified.For Paneth cells,Paneth cluster 3 was observed in the resting state of normal jejunum.After I 45 min/R 90 min,three new subsets were found,in which Paneth cluster 1 had good antigen presentation activity.The main functions of goblet cells were to synthesize and secrete mucus,and a novel subcluster(goblet cluster 5)with highly proliferative ability was discovered in I 45 min/R 90 min group.As a major part of immune system,the changes in T cells with important roles were clarified.Notably,enterocyte cells secreted Guca2b to interact with Gucy2c receptor on the membranes of stem cells,TA cells,Paneth cells,and goblet cells to elicit intercellular communication.One marker known as glutathione S-transferase mu 3(GSTM3)affected intestinal mucosal barrier function by adjusting mitogen-activated protein kinases(MAPK)signaling during II/R injury.The data on the heterogeneity of intestinal cells,cellular communication and the mechanism of GSTM3 provide a cellular basis for treating II/R injury. 展开更多

Objective:To test two theories from traditional Chinese medicine:'exterior -interior relationship between the lung and large intestine' and 'treating from the intestine principle for lung disorders'.The influence of intestine-based treatment using Xuan Bai Cheng Qi Tang (XBCQT) on the concentration of three trace elements-copper (Cu),zinc (Zn),and manganese (Mn)-was observed in the tissues of the lung,small intestine,large intestine,and stomach of rats suffering from chronic obstructive pulmonary disease (COPD).Methods:Thirty-five male Wistar rats were divided randomly and equally into five groups:control;model;Fei treatment (A);Chang treatment (B);and Fei-Chang treatment (C).A rat model of COPD was prepared by tracheal injection of lipopolysaccharide plus exposure to cigarette smoke.Treatments with medicinal herbs started day-22 of administration and exposure to cigarette smoke for 7 days.The control group and model group were administered physiologic (0.9%) saline solution via the stomach.After 7 days of intervention,the tissues of the lung,small intestine,large intestine,and stomach were removed.Inductively coupled plasma-atomic emission spectroscopy was used to detect the levels of Cu,Zn,and Mn in those tissues.Results:Compared with the control group,the Cu concentration in the tissues of the small intestine,large intestine,and stomach increased significantly in the model group (P <.05);the Mn concentration in the tissues of the lung,large intestine,and stomach increased significantly in the model group (P <.05);the Zn concentration in the tissues of the lung and large intestine decreased significantly in the model group (P <.05).In comparison of the model group:the Cu concentration in the tissues of the lung and large intestine decreased significantly in the B group (P <.05);the Mn concentration in the tissues of the lung,small intestine,and large intestine decreased significantly in the B group (P <.05);the Zn concentration in the tissues of the lung,small intestine,and large intestine increased significantly in the B group (P <.05).For the A group versus C group comparison,the Zn concentration in the tissues of the small intestine and stomach increased significantly in the latter (P <.05).Conclusion:This study showed that 'treating from the intestine' using Xuan Bai Cheng Qi Tang and its modified formulae can regulate the concentration of trace elements in the main organs of COPD rats.This may be one of the mechanisms for intestine-based treatment for COPD. 展开更多

The frequency of primary small intestinal adenocarcinoma is increasing but is still low.Its frequency is approximately 3%of that of colorectal adenocarcinoma.Considering that the small intestine occupies 90%of the surface area of the gastrointestinal tract,small intestinal adenocarcinoma is very rare.The main site of small intestinal adenocarcinoma is the proximal small intestine.Based on this characteristic,dietary animal proteins/lipids and bile concentrations are implicated and reported to be involved in carcinogenesis.Since most nutrients are absorbed in the proximal small intestine,the effect of absorbable intestinal content is a suitable explanation for why small intestinal adenocarcinoma is more common in the proximal small intestine.The proportion of aerobic bacteria is high in the proximal small intestine,but the absolute number of bacteria is low.In addition,the length and density of villi are greater in the proximal small intestine.However,the involvement of villi is considered to be low because the number of small intestinal adenocarcinomas is much smaller than that of colorectal adenocarcinomas.On the other hand,the reason for the low incidence of small intestinal adenocarcinoma in the distal small intestine may be that immune organs reside there.Genetic and disease factors increase the likelihood of small intestinal adenocarcinoma.In carcinogenesis experiments in which the positions of the small and large intestines were exchanged,tumors still occurred in the large intestinal mucosa more often.In other words,the influence of the intestinal contents is small,and there is a large difference in epithelial properties between the small intestine and the large intestine.In conclusion,small intestinal adenocarcinoma is rare compared to large intestinal adenocarcinoma due to the nature of the epithelium.It is reasonable to assume that diet is a trigger for small intestinal adenocarcinoma. 展开更多

AIM:To study the effects of combined early fluid resuscitation and hydrogen inhalation on septic shockinduced lung and intestine injuries.METHODS:Wistar male rats were randomly divided into four groups:control group(Group A,n = 15);septic shock group(Group B,n = 15);early fluid resuscitation-treated septic shock group(Group C,n = 15);and early fluid resuscitation and inhalation of 2% hydrogentreated septic shock group(Group D,n = 15).The activity of hydroxyl radicals,myeloperoxidase(MPO),superoxide dismutase(SOD),diamine oxidase(DAO),and the concentration of malonaldehyde(MDA) in the lung and intestinal tissue were assessed according to the corresponding kits.Hematoxylin and eosin staining was carried out to detect the pathology of the lung and intestine.The expression levels of interleukin(IL)-6,IL-8,and tumor necrosis factor(TNF)-α in lung and intestine tissue were detected by enzyme-linked immunosorbent assay method.The expression levels of Fas and Bcl2 in lung tissues were determined by immunohistochemistry and Western blotting.RESULTS:Septic shock elicited a significant increase in the levels of MDA(10.17 ± 1.12 nmol/mg protein vs 2.98 ± 0.64 nmol/mg protein) and MPO(6.79 ± 1.02 U/g wet tissue vs 1.69 ± 0.14 U/g wet tissue) in lung tissues.These effects were not significantly decreased by Group C pretreatment,but were significantly reduced by Group D pretreatment(MDA:4.45 ± 1.13 nmol/mg protein vs 9.56 ± 1.37 nmol/mg protein;MPO:2.58 ± 0.21 U/g wet tissue vs 6.02 ± 1.16 U/g wet tissue).The activity of SOD(250.32 ± 8.56 U/mg protein vs 365.78 ± 10.26 U/mg protein) in lung tissues was decreased after septic shock,and was not significantly increased by Group C pretreatment,but was significantly enhanced by Group D pretreatment(331.15 ± 9.64 U/mg protein vs 262.98 ± 5.47 U/mg protein).Histological evidence of lung hemorrhage,neutrophil infiltration and overexpression of IL-6,IL-8,and TNF-α was observed in lung tissues,all of which were attenuated by Group C and further alleviated by Group D pretreatment.Septic shock also elicited a significant increase in the levels of MDA,MPO and DAO(6.54 ± 0.68 kU/L vs 4.32 ± 0.33 kU/L) in intestinal tissues,all of which were further increased by Group C,but significantly reduced by Group D pretreatment.Increased Chiu scoring and overexpression of IL-6,IL-8 and TNF-α were observed in intestinal tissues,all of which were attenuated by Group C and further attenuated by Group D pretreatment.CONCLUSION:Combined early fluid resuscitation and hydrogen inhalation may protect the lung and intestine of the septic shock rats from the damage induced by oxidative stress and the inflammatory reaction. 展开更多

Generally, proton-pump inhibitors(PPIs) have great benefit for patients with acid related disease with less frequently occurring side effects. According to a recent report, PPIs provoke dysbiosis of the small intestinal bacterial flora, exacerbating nonsteroidal anti-inflammatory drug-induced small intestinal injury.Several meta-analyses and systematic reviews have reported that patients treated with PPIs, as well as post-gastrectomy patients, have a higher frequency of small intestinal bacterial overgrowth(SIBO) compared to patients who lack the aforementioned conditions.Furthermore, there is insufficient evidence that these conditions induce Clostridium difficile infection. At this time, PPI-induced dysbiosis is considered a type of SIBO. It now seems likely that intestinal bacterial flora influence many diseases, such as inflammatory bowel disease, diabetes mellitus, obesity, nonalcoholic fatty liver disease, and autoimmune diseases.When attempting to control intestinal bacterial flora with probiotics, prebiotics, and fecal microbiota transplantation, etc., the influence of acid suppression therapy, especially PPIs, should not be overlooked. 展开更多

Background: Following the intake of Fusarium mycotoxin-contaminated feed,small intestines may be exposed to high levels of toxic substances that can potentially damage intestinal functions in livestock.It is well known that Fusarium mycotoxins will lead a breakdown of the normally impeccable epithelial barrier,resulting in the development of a "leaky" gut.H2 administration with different methods has been proved definitely potentials to prevent serious intestinal diseases.The goal of this study is to investigate the roles of lactulose(LAC) and hydrogenrich water(HRW) in preventing intestinal dysfunction in piglets fed Fusarium mycotoxin-contaminated feed.Methods: A total of 24 female piglets were evenly assigned to 4 groups: negative control(NC) group,mycotoxincontaminated(MC) feed group,MC feed with LAC treatment(MC + LAC),and MC feed with HRW treatment(MC +HRW),respectively.Piglets in the NC group were fed uncontaminated control diet,while remaining piglets were fed Fusarium mycotoxin-contaminated diet.For the NC and MC groups,10 mL/kg body weight(BW) of hydrogen-free water(HFW) was orally administrated to piglets twice daily;while in the MC + LAC and MC + HRW groups,piglets were treated with the same dose of LAC solution(500 mg/kg BW) and HRW twice daily,respectively.On d 25,serum was collected and used for biochemical analysis.Intestinal tissues were sampled for morphological examination as well as relative genes and protein expression analysis.Results: Our data showed that Fusarium mycotoxins induced higher serum diamine oxidase(DAO) activities(P < 0.05),D-lactic acid levels(P < 0.01),and endotoxin status(P < 0.01),lower villus height(P < 0.01) and ratio of villus height to crypt depth(P < 0.05) in small intestine,greater apoptosis index and higher mRNA expression related to tight junctions(P < 0.05).In addition,the distribution and down-regulation of claudin-3(CLDN3) protein in the small intestinal was also observed.As expected,oral administrations of HRW and LAC were found to remarkably provide beneficial effects against Fusarium mycotoxin-induced apoptosis and intestinal leaking.Moreover,either HRW or LAC treatments were also revealed to prevent abnormal intestinal morphological changes,disintegrate tight junctions,and restore the expression and distribution of CLDN3 protein in the small intestinal mucosal layer in female piglets that were fed Fusarium mycotoxins contaminated diet.Conclusions: Our data suggest that orally administrations of HRW and LAC result in less Fusarium mycotoxininduced apoptosis and leak in the small intestine.Either HRW or LAC treatments could prevent the abnormal changes of intestinal morphology and molecular response of tight junctions as well as restore the distribution and expression of CLDN3 protein of small intestinal mucosa layer in female piglets that were fed Fusarium mycotoxins contaminated diet. 展开更多

BACKGROUND:Severe acute pancreatitis (SAP) is characterized by fatal pathogenic conditions and a high mortality.It is important to study SAP complicated with multiple organ injury.In this study we compared the protective effects of three traditional Chinese medicines (Ligustrazine,Kakonein and Panax Notoginsenoside) on the small intestine and immune organs (thymus,spleen and lymph nodes) of rats with SAP and explored their mechanism of action.METHODS:One hundred forty-four rats with SAP were randomly divided into model control,Ligustrazine-treated,Kakonein-treated,and Panax Notoginsenoside-treated groups (n=36 per group).Another 36 normal rats comprised the sham-operated group.According to the different time points after operation,the experimental rats in each group were subdivided into 3-,6-and 12-hour subgroups (n=12).At various time points after operation,the mortality rate of rats and pathological changes in the small intestine and immune organs were recorded and the serum amylase levels were measured.RESULTS:Compared to the model control groups,the mortality rates in all treated groups declined and the pathological changes in the small intestine and immune tissues were relieved to different degrees.The serum amylase levels in the three treated groups were significantly lower than those in the model control group at 12 hours.The pathological severity scores for the small intestinal mucosa,thymus and spleen (at 3 and 12 hours) in the Ligustrazine-treated group,for the thymus (at 3 and 12 hours) and spleen (at 3 and 6 hours) in the Kakonein-treated group,and for the thymus (at 3 hours)and spleen (at 3 hours) in the Panax Notoginsenoside-treated group were significantly lower than those in the model control group.The pathological severity scores of the small intestinal mucosa (at 6 and 12 hours) and thymus (at 6 hours) in the Ligustrazine-treated group were significantly lower than those in the Kakonein-and Panax Notoginsenoside-treated groups.CONCLUSIONS:All the three traditional Chinese drugs significantly alleviated the pathological changes in the small intestine and immune organs of SAP rats.Ligustrazine was the most effective one among them. 展开更多

Primary malignant tumors of the small intestine are rare,comprising less than 2%of all gastrointestinal tumors.An 85-year-old woman was admitted with fever of 40℃ and marked abdominal distension.Her medical history was unremarkable,but blood examination showed elevated inflammatory markers.Abdominal computed tomography showed a giant tumor with central necrosis,extending from the epigastrium to the pelvic cavity.Giant gastrointestinal stromal tumor of the small intestine communicating with the gastrointestinal tract or with superimposed infection was suspected.Because no improvement occurred in response to antibiotics,surgery was performed.Laparotomy revealed giant hemorrhagic tumor adherent to the small intestine and occupying the peritoneal cavity.The giant tumor was a solid tumor weighing 3490 g,measuring24 cm×17.5 cm×18 cm and showing marked necrosis.Histologically,the tumor comprised spindle-shaped cells with anaplastic large nuclei.Immunohistochemical studies showed tumor cells positive for vimentin,CD31,and factorⅧ-related antigen,but negative for c-kit and CD34.Angiosarcoma was diagnosed.Although no postoperative complications occurred,the patient experienced enlargement of multiple metastatic tumors in the abdominal cavity and died 42 d postoperatively.The prognosis of small intestinal angiosarcoma is very poor,even after volume-reducing palliative surgery. 展开更多

Cancer of the small intestine is very uncommon.There are 4 main histological subtypes:adenocarcinomas,carcinoid tumors,lymphoma and sarcoma.The incidence of small intestine cancer has increased over the past several decades with a four-fold increase for carcinoid tumors,less dramatic rises for adenocarcinoma and lymphoma and stable sarcoma rates.Very little is known about its etiology.An increased risk has been noted for individuals with Crohn's disease,celiac disease,adenoma,familial adenomatous polyposis and Peutz-Jeghers syndrome.Several behavioral risk factors including consumption of red or smoked meat,saturated fat,obesity and smoking have been suggested.The prognosis for carcinomas of the small intestine cancer is poor(5 years relative survival < 30%),better for lymphomas and sarcomas,and best for carcinoid tumors.There has been no signif icant change in longterm survival rates for any of the 4 histological subtypes.Currently,with the possible exceptions of obesity and cigarette smoking,there are no established modifiable risk factors which might provide the foundation for a prevention program aimed at reducing the incidence and mortality of cancers of the small intestine.More research with better quality and sufficient statistical power is needed to get better understanding of the etiology and biology of this cancer.In addition,more studies should be done to assess not only exposures of interest,but also host susceptibility. 展开更多

Background:The establishment of stable microbiota in early life is beneficial to the individual.Changes in the intestinal environment during early life play a crucial role in modulating the gut microbiota.Therefore,early intervention to change the intestinal environment can be regarded as a new regulation strategy for the growth and health of poultry.However,the effects of intestinal environmental changes on host physiology and metabolism are rarely reported.This study was conducted to investigate the effects of early inoculation with caecal fermentation broth on small intestine morphology,gene expression of tight junction proteins in the ileum,and cecum microbial metabolism of broilers.Results:Our data showed that early inoculation with caecal fermentation broth could improve intestine morphology.The small intestine villus height was significantly increased(P<0.05)in the intervened broilers compared to the control group,especially on day 28.A similar result was observed in the ratio of villus height to crypt depth(P<0.05).Meanwhile,we found early inoculation significantly increased(P<0.05)the expression levels of zonula occludens-1(ZO1)on days 14 and 28,claudin-1(CLDN1)on day 28,whereas the gene expression of claudin-2(CLDN2)was significantly decreased(P<0.05)on days 14 and 28.Gas chromatography time-of-flight/mass spectrometry(GC-TOF/MS)technology was further implemented to systematically evaluate the microbial metabolite profiles.Principal component analysis(PCA)and orthogonal partial least squares discriminant analysis(OPLS-DA)displayed a distinct trend towards separation between the fermentation broth group(F group)and the control group(C group).The differentially expressed metabolites were identified,and they were mainly functionally enriched in beta-alanine metabolism and biosynthesis of unsaturated fatty acids.In addition,1,3-diaminopropane was selected as a key biomarker that responded to early inoculation with caecal fermentation broth.Conclusions:These results provide insight into intestinal metabolomics and confirm that early inoculation with caecal fermentation broth can be used as a potential strategy to improve intestinal health of broilers. 展开更多

According to the physiological and anatomical characteristics of small intestine,neglecting the effect of its motility on the distribution and absorption of drug and nutrient,Y.Miyamoto et al.proposed a model of two-dimensional laminar flow in a circular porous tube with permeable wall and calculated the concentration profile of drugby numerical analysis.In this paper,we give a steady-state analytical solution of the above model including deactivationterm.The obtained results are in agreement with the results of their numerical analysis. Moreover the analytical solution presented in this paper reveals the relation among the physiological parameters of the model and describes the basic absorption rule of drug and nutrient through the intestinal wall and hence pro- vides a theoretical basis for determining the permeability and reflection coefficient through in situ experiments. 展开更多

The small and large intestine of the gastrointestinal tract(GIT) have evolved to have discrete functions with distinct anatomies and immune cell composition.The importance of these differences is underlined when considering that different pathogens have uniquely adapted to live in each region of the gut.Furthermore,different regions of the GIT are also associated with differences in susceptibility to diseases such as cancer and chronic inflammation.The large and small intestine,given their anatomical and functional differences,should be seen as two separate immunological sites.However,this distinction is often ignored with findings from one area of the GIT being inappropriately extrapolated to the other.Focussing largely on the murine small and large intestine,this review addresses the literature relating to the immunology and biology of the two sites,drawing comparisons between them and clarifying similarities and differences.We also highlight the gaps in our understanding and where further research is needed. 展开更多
